Till a few years back, gasifiers were essentially used to produce gaseous fuel out of solid fossil fuel. Easy availability of liquid fuel and gaseous fuel have made the gasifier technology obsolete. However for small decentralized power production use, wood based gasifier had become an alternative option. Problems with the cleaning of producer gas and derating of gas engine have made the demand of wood based gasifier meager.

Off late for large thermal application, biomass has become a very attractive option due to cleaner combustion. Firing of many biomass products having a very high moisture content (above 70%) has never been an attractive option and was done only as an abatement of pollution problems.

With the development of drying and densification technology, biomass gasifiers (burning biomass pellets & briquettes) have become quite a formidable option for thermal energy production.

In India and Africa, many industries are successfully using biomass in gasifiers on account of environmental consideration and ease of availability, after drying and densification. The major industries are:

  1. Distilleries (spent wash)
  2. DDGS (Distillers Dry Grain Solution)
  3. Press Mud Industry
  4. Coir Pith Industry
  5. Other waste processing industries

Gasifiers are the most clean burning option for using biomass.
